Transaction dfa83b21aeef7ae443c55da902aa5d76310b6c47d850d2e8c567a68db3cf4898
1 Input
1 Output
-
dfa83b21aeef7ae443c55da902aa5d76310b6c47d850d2e8c567a68db3cf4898:0
- value
- 1305559
- script pubkey
- OP_0 OP_PUSHBYTES_32 c98cb32a70c6d96fc6e48908a0bba28edf58d4c8fab2a515f17ea947cffac195
- address
- bc1qexxtx2nscmvkl3hy3yy2pwaz3m0434xgl2e2290306550nl6cx2sy7ga3j